Maison > interface Web > js tutoriel > Pourquoi l'utilisation d'un seul point ne parvient-elle pas à accéder aux propriétés entières en JavaScript ?

Pourquoi l'utilisation d'un seul point ne parvient-elle pas à accéder aux propriétés entières en JavaScript ?

Barbara Streisand
Libérer: 2024-11-21 04:33:10
original
163 Les gens l'ont consulté

Why Does Using a Single Dot Fail to Access Integer Properties in JavaScript?

Pourquoi la notation à point unique ne peut-elle pas accéder aux propriétés d'un entier ?

Lorsque vous essayez d'invoquer une propriété d'un entier à l'aide d'un seul point, telle que :

3.toFixed(5)
Copier après la connexion

vous pouvez rencontrer une erreur de syntaxe. En effet, le point (.) fait intrinsèquement partie du nombre, conduisant à l'interprétation du code comme suit :

(3.)toFixed(5)
Copier après la connexion

Il en résulte une erreur de syntaxe puisqu'on ne peut pas suivre un nombre immédiatement avec un identifiant .

Pour résoudre ce problème, des méthodes doivent être utilisées pour séparer le point du nombre. Une de ces approches consiste à mettre le nombre entre parenthèses :

(3).toFixed(5)
Copier après la connexion

Cela empêche effectivement que le point soit interprété comme faisant partie du nombre, permettant ainsi l'accès à la propriété toFixed.

Alors que diverses alternatives existent, l'utilisation de parenthèses est sans doute l'approche la plus simple. D'autres méthodes incluent :

  • Points doubles : 3..toFixed(5)
  • Ajout d'un espace : 3 .toFixed(5)
  • Utilisation de la notation entre crochets : 3 ["toFixed"](5)

Sélectionnez la méthode qui correspond le mieux à vos préférences et à votre style de codage.

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

source:php.cn
Déclaration de ce site Web
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n
Derniers articles par auteur
Tutoriels populaires
Plus>
Derniers téléchargements
Plus>
effets Web
Code source du site Web
Matériel du site Web
Modèle frontal